Debian Jenkins配置中的性能监控与调优
小樊
40
2025-09-07 04:45:24
性能监控
- 插件监控:使用Monitoring Plugin生成服务器状态报告,或通过Prometheus插件导出指标至Grafana可视化。
- 命令行工具:通过
top
、htop
或jstat
监控资源使用情况,分析CPU、内存占用。
- 日志分析:定期查看Jenkins日志,排查构建失败或异常耗时问题。
性能调优
- 硬件优化:增加内存、使用SSD存储,提升I/O性能。
- JVM调优:在
/etc/default/jenkins
中调整JAVA_ARGS
,合理设置堆大小(如-Xms512m -Xmx2048m
)。
- 并发控制:在Jenkins全局配置中限制并行构建数,避免资源竞争。
- 插件管理:定期更新插件,移除未使用的插件,减少内存消耗。
- 分布式构建:配置Slave节点分担主节点压力,按需分配任务。